Evaluating True HEPA Particle Filtration Efficiency

The primary defense against the visible, solid elements of smoke is a high-performance True HEPA filter. These medical-grade filters are structurally engineered to capture at least 99.97% of airborne microparticles as small as 0.3 microns. This physical barrier is crucial because smoke particles typically measure between 0.1 and 1.0 microns, allowing them to penetrate deep into human lungs.

Verified buyers on Amazon frequently note that upgrading to a true HEPA system significantly reduced their morning congestion. These filters use a dense, randomized web of fiberglass fibers to trap microscopic pollutants through interception and diffusion. This ensures that fine ash and soot are permanently locked away, preventing them from settling onto your furniture.

However, some critical reviews point out that standard HEPA filters can clog rapidly when exposed to continuous, heavy smoke. When the filter becomes overloaded, system airflow decreases, and the motor must work harder to circulate clean air. This makes regular visual inspections and timely replacements essential for maintaining your system’s overall performance.

The Vital Role of Carbon Adsorption in Odor Control

While HEPA filters excel at trapping solid particles, they are completely ineffective against the gaseous chemicals and odors found in smoke. Tobacco emissions contain hundreds of toxic volatile organic compounds, such as formaldehyde and benzene, which pass straight through particle filters. To neutralize these dangerous gases, an air purifier must incorporate a heavy bed of high-grade activated carbon.

Activated carbon filters undergo a physical activation process that creates millions of microscopic pores between the carbon atoms. These pores attract and trap gas molecules through a molecular process called adsorption, locking them away within the carbon matrix. This chemical capture is the only reliable way to eliminate lingering smoke odors from your home.

Experienced users online advise looking for purifiers that use real, pelletized activated carbon rather than thin, carbon-coated pads. Thick carbon canisters contain significantly more surface area, allowing them to neutralize intense odors for much longer. Investing in a robust carbon bed is key to keeping your indoor air smelling fresh and clean.

Analyzing CADR and Room Coverage Benchmarks

The Clean Air Delivery Rate, or CADR, is the global industry standard for measuring how quickly a purifier cleans a room. This rating is meas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M) and is calculated separately for smoke, dust, and pollen. A higher CADR rating indicates that the system can cycle clean air through a specific room size more rapidly.

To effectively manage smoke, your system should perform at least four to five complete air exchanges per hour. This high circulation rate ensures that new smoke is processed and cleaned before it has a chance to settle. Always match the unit’s rated room coverage with the actual dimensions of your living space.

Some critical consumer feedback warns that using a small, underpowered purifier in a large living room leads to poor results. The system will run constantly on high speed, creating annoying noise without ever fully clearing the air. Selecting a model with an appropriate CADR rating ensures quiet, efficient, and highly effective performance.

Preventing Secondary Volatile Organic Chemical Accumulation

When tobacco or wood burns, it releases a complex mixture of gaseous chemicals known as volatile organic compounds, or VOCs. These gases can linger in your indoor air long after the visible smoke has cleared, clinging to carpets and drywall. Over time, these trapped chemicals can slowly release back into your living spaces, causing persistent, stale odors.

To prevent this secondary accumulation, it is crucial to run your air purifier continuously on a low, energy-efficient setting. Continuous operation ensures that any off-gassing chemical vapors are actively captured by the activated carbon filter before they can accumulate. This habit is especially important in homes with thick carpets, heavy drapes, or fabric upholstery.

Many modern purifiers feature an automatic eco-mode that runs the fan only when pollution levels rise, saving you money on electricity. However, for active smoker households, running the system on a low, constant speed is often more effective for odor control. Keeping the air in constant motion prevents pockets of stale, chemical-laden air from forming in your rooms.

Optimizing System Placement and Filter Replacement Cycles

Proper placement is essential for ensuring your purifier can draw in and clean the air from your entire room. Avoid placing your unit in tight corners, behind large furniture, or directly against walls, as this severely restricts its intake. Ideally, position the system in a central location with at least two feet of clear space on all sides.

Additionally, establishing a consistent filter replacement schedule is the best way to protect your unit’s motor and maintain clean air. While many manufacturers suggest replacing filters every six months, heavy smoke environments may require changes every three to four months. A heavily clogged filter blocks airflow, putting immense strain on the fan motor and increasing your energy bills.
